Proverbs 25 20
Singing happy songs to someone who's broken-hearted is like taking off your coat on a cold day, or pouring vinegar onto an open wound.

EAS Proverbs 25:20If you sing to a very sad man to make him happy, it only gives him more pain. It is like you are taking away his coat on a cold day, or you are putting vinegar on his wound.
NAS Proverbs 25:20Like one who takes off a garment on a cold day, or like vinegar on soda, Is one who sings songs to a troubled heart.
KJV Proverbs 25:20As he that taketh away a garment in cold weather, and as vinegar upon nitre, so is he that singeth songs to a heavy heart.
